Amadeus launches online booking tool

Amadeus is rolling out a self-service online rebooking solution to save travel agents time and money and improve customer loyalty.

The Amadeus Ticket Changer (ATC) Shopper, enables customers of participating travel agencies to go online to rebook their flights any day, any time. This latest addition to the ATC suite is the world’s first self-service online rebooking solution.

ATC Shopper can modify all types of tickets and fares, before and after departure. With easy 24/7 online access to different routes, itineraries and schedules, customers can rebook their flights on their own and feel confident that they secured a good deal. For online travel agents, ATC Shopper can greatly reduce the number of calls to call centres, lower the risk of errors, and improve customer satisfaction and loyalty.

Amadeus expects that ATC Shopper’s ease of use will increase flight changes and as a result, improve earnings for online travel agencies offering this option to their customers.
